Expenditure on medicines and health products in Nabire Regency in August was 1.42%. This figure is higher than the previous month, which recorded -0.27%. Among the seven inflation groups measured in this region, the health group contributed 0.57% to inflation in Nabire Regency.

The Central Bureau of Statistics (BPS) reported that the consumer price index (CPI) for health in Nabire Regency was at 101.08 in August 2024, higher than the previous month's 99.66.

This regency/city is a new area included in the 2024 CPI calculation. Previously, referring to the 2018 CPI, BPS only calculated 90 regencies/cities. Starting in 2024, using the 2022 base year, the CPI is calculated based on consumption patterns from the cost of living survey (SBH) in 150 regencies/cities in 2022 (2022=100).

Historically, inflation data for this region has only been available since the beginning of 2024. Compared to the beginning of the year, expenditure in Nabire Regency has grown by -0.43% (year to date/ytd).
